2-14 Sweeps & FSK<br />
Sweep/FSK RATE<br />
Sweep/FSK FREQUENCIES<br />
Start and Stop Frequencies<br />
Sweep/FSK OUTPUT<br />
The duration of the sweep is set by [RATE], and the value is entered or<br />
modified with the keypad. The sweep rate may be set over the range of<br />
0.01 Hz to1 kHz. The sweep rate is the inverse of the sweep time, a 0.01 Hz<br />
rate is equal to a 100s sweep time, and a1 kHz rate is equal to a 1 ms sweep<br />
time. For a TRIANGLE sweep the sweep time is the total time to sweep up<br />
and down. If FSK is selected from the UNI/BI menu, then the "Sweep Rate"<br />
button sets the FSK Rate. If the rate is set to 0 Hz then the rear panel FSK<br />
BNC input toggles between the two preset frequencies. For any non zero<br />
rate the <strong>DS335</strong> will toggle between the two preset frequencies at the<br />
specified rate. The maximum internal FSK rate is 50 kHz.<br />
The <strong>DS335</strong> may sweep over any portion of its frequency range: 1 µHz to<br />
3.1 MHz for sine and square waves, 1 µHz to 100 kHz for triangle and ramp<br />
waves. The sweep span is limited to six decades for logarithmic sweeps.<br />
The <strong>DS335</strong>'s sweep range is set by entering the start and stop frequencies.<br />
In FSK mode, the <strong>DS335</strong> will toggle between any two frequencies: 1µHz to<br />
3.1 MHz for sine and square waves, and 1 µHz to 100 kHz for triangle and<br />
ramp waves. There are no restrictions on the values of the start and stop<br />
frequencies for linear sweeps.<br />
To enter the start and stop frequency press the [START FREQ] and [STOP<br />
FREQ] keys. The span value is restricted to sweep frequencies greater than<br />
zero and less than or equal to the maximum allowed frequency. If the stop<br />
frequency is greater than the start frequency, the <strong>DS335</strong> will sweep up. If the<br />
start frequency is larger the <strong>DS335</strong> will sweep down. If FSK is enabled the<br />
<strong>DS335</strong> toggles between the Start and Stop frequencies at the Sweep/FSK<br />
Rate. If the rate has been set to zero then the rear panel FSK input is active.<br />
A TTL low level activates the start frequency and a TTL high level activates<br />
the stop frequency.<br />
The rear-panel SWP/FSK output is synchronous with the sweep rate. This<br />
output emits a TTL pulse at the beginning of every sweep cycle and can be<br />
used to trigger an oscilloscope. When the start frequency is selected, the<br />
Sweep output is at 0 Volts, and when the Stop frequency is selected the<br />
Sweep level is at 5 Volts. The Sweep output is synchronous with the<br />
frequency shifts.<br />
FSK Input<br />
The FSK input accepts TTL level signals. When enabled (FSK mode with<br />
0 Hz rate), it is sampled at a 10 MHz frequency by the <strong>DS335</strong>. A low TTL<br />
level selects the start frequency, and a high TTL level selects the stop<br />
frequency (see example below). When the FSK Input is being used, the<br />
Sweep output is disabled and stays at 0 Volts.<br />
